IND vs ENG 4th Test: Why have pitches in England been flat?

Image
England's cricket pitches this summer have been unusually flat and high-scoring, deviating from traditional conditions. Exhausted grounds, due to increased cricket including The Hundred, contribute to this. India pacer Akash Deep's expectations of swing were quickly dispelled. Some believe England prefers flatter wickets to facilitate their aggressive 'Bazball' batting style. from Cricket News: IPL Cricket Live Score, Results, Upcoming IPL match Schedules | Times of India https://ift.tt/BeTSgzd via IFTTT

IND vs ENG: Drop Crisis! India's catching woes undermine Test campaign in England

Image
India's Test team is struggling in England, trailing 1-2 due to poor fielding. Dropped catches have been extremely costly, with a catching efficiency of just 60.90% compared to England's 78.30%. Missed opportunities in key moments have allowed England's batsmen to score crucial runs. Improving catching is essential for India to win the remaining Tests and salvage the series. from Cricket News: IPL Cricket Live Score, Results, Upcoming IPL match Schedules | Times of India https://ift.tt/4eOCf1z via IFTTT

Starc, Boland wreak havoc as West Indies bowled out for just 27 runs

Image
Mitchell Starc's devastating spell of 6-9 and Scott Boland's hat-trick propelled Australia to a dominant 176-run victory over the West Indies in the third test at Kingston, completing a 3-0 series sweep. The West Indies were bowled out for a paltry 27, the second-lowest total in test history, as Starc also reached his 400th test wicket. from Cricket News: IPL Cricket Live Score, Results, Upcoming IPL match Schedules | Times of India https://ift.tt/iHDr8LB via IFTTT
